| H A D | pinctrl-uclass.c | fab50c1fafdacbccbd42aeaf7b1aef1af07af78e Fri Aug 02 12:48:00 UTC 2019 Patrick Delaunay <patrick.delaunay@st.com> UPSTREAM: dm: pinctrl: introduce PINCONF_RECURSIVE option
In the Linux pinctrl binding, the pin configuration nodes don't need to be direct children of the pin controller device (may be grandchildren for example). This behavior is managed with the pinconfig u-class which recursively bind all the sub-node of the pin controller.
But for some binding (when pin configuration is only children of pin controller) that is not necessary. U-Boot can save memory and reduce the number of pinconf instance when this feature is deactivated (for arch stm32mp for example for SPL).
This patch allows to control this feature with a new option CONFIG_PINCONF_RECURSIVE when it is possible for each individual pin controller device.
